Prospective Threats



Prior to embarking on a medical weight reduction program, it's prudent to be knowledgeable about the possible dangers included. While medical weight-loss programs can be effective, there are certain threats to consider.

One feasible threat is the advancement of dietary deficiencies due to a restricted diet or lowered food consumption. This can result in health problems if not very carefully checked by health care specialists. In addition, some fat burning medications or treatments might have negative effects such as nausea or vomiting, looseness of the bowels, or sleep problems. It is necessary to go over these prospective negative effects with your medical professional prior to starting any kind of weight reduction program.



Another danger to be familiar with is the possibility of gaining back the weight after completing the program. Without proper way of life modifications and ongoing support, it can be testing to keep fat burning in the long-term. Additionally, quick weight-loss can in some cases lead to muscle mass loss, which can negatively influence your metabolic process.

It's necessary to comprehend these dangers and job very closely with your doctor to decrease them while making the most of the advantages of your weight management trip.
